The age-old debate of whether socks should be classified as undergarments continues to spark interesting discussions in fashion circles and everyday conversations. While this might seem like a simple question at first glance, the answer involves considering various factors, from cultural perspectives to practical usage.
Historical Context
Historically, socks served primarily as a protective layer between feet and shoes, much like how traditional undergarments protect and provide comfort. In ancient times, they were considered essential garments worn beneath other clothing, supporting the argument for their classification as undergarments.
Modern Fashion Perspective
Today's fashion landscape has transformed how we view socks as style statements rather than mere necessities. When socks are deliberately shown off with shorts or cropped pants, they transcend their traditional underwear status and become legitimate fashion accessories.
Function and Purpose
The primary purpose of socks remains practical - they absorb moisture, provide cushioning, and protect feet. Custom athletic socks exemplify this functionality, designed specifically for performance and comfort during physical activities.
Cultural Considerations
Different cultures view socks differently. Some fashion enthusiasts argue that socks occupy a unique category between undergarments and accessories. This perspective has gained traction as custom sock designs become increasingly popular for both personal expression and professional branding.
Social Context
The social acceptability of visible socks varies by situation. While team socks are meant to be displayed proudly during sports events, dress socks in professional settings are typically meant to remain discreet, similar to traditional undergarments.
Wrapping Up
While socks technically fulfill some functions of undergarments, their modern role extends far beyond this simple classification. They've evolved into a versatile clothing item that can be both functional underwear and fashionable accessory, depending on the context and intention of wear. The answer to whether socks are undergarments ultimately depends on how and when they're worn, making them one of the most adaptable pieces in our wardrobes.
